在当今的制造业和工程领域,计算机辅助设计(CAD)和计算机辅助制造(CAM)软件是不可或缺的工具,UG编程,即Unigraphics编程,是一种广泛应用于机械设计和制造的软件技术,它能够帮助工程师和设计师创建复杂的三维模型,并将其转化为实际的制造过程,市场上的UG编程软件往往价格不菲,这使得许多小型企业或个人用户望而却步,幸运的是,有一些免费的UG编程软件资源可以帮助用户入门并实现基本的设计和制造任务,本文将为您提供一份全面的指南,介绍这些免费资源,并指导您如何有效地利用它们。
免费UG编程软件概述
免费UG编程软件通常包括开源软件和一些企业提供的试用版软件,这些软件虽然可能在功能上不如商业版全面,但对于学习基础的UG编程技能和进行小规模项目设计来说已经足够。
开源UG编程软件推荐
2.1 FreeCAD
FreeCAD是一个开源的参数化三维CAD模型构建器,它提供了一套完整的工具,用于建模、装配、模拟和渲染,FreeCAD的用户界面与商业软件相似,因此对于熟悉UG编程的用户来说,上手相对容易,它支持多种文件格式,并且有一个活跃的社区,用户可以在社区中寻求帮助和分享经验。
2.2 LibreCAD
LibreCAD是一个开源的二维CAD软件,虽然它主要用于二维设计,但对于初学者来说,它是学习CAD基础操作的良好起点,LibreCAD界面简洁,易于操作,适合进行简单的二维绘图和编辑。
2.3 OpenSCAD
OpenSCAD是一个用于创建三维CAD模型的脚本语言和软件,它允许用户通过编写代码来生成复杂的三维模型,虽然它的学习曲线相对较陡,但对于喜欢编程的用户来说,OpenSCAD提供了一种独特的建模方式。
企业版UG编程软件的免费试用
除了开源软件,一些商业软件也提供了免费试用版,用户可以在有限的时间内体验完整的软件功能。
3.1 UGS/NX
UGS/NX(现在称为Siemens NX)是市场上领先的UG编程软件之一,它提供了一个强大的平台,用于产品设计、工程和制造,Siemens NX提供免费试用版,用户可以在官方网站上申请试用。
3.2 SolidWorks
SolidWorks是一个广泛使用的三维CAD设计软件,它提供了一个用户友好的界面和强大的功能集,SolidWorks提供免费试用版,用户可以在其官方网站上下载并体验完整的软件功能。
如何选择适合的UG编程免费软件
在选择UG编程免费软件时,您需要考虑以下几个因素:
4.1 项目需求
根据您的项目需求选择合适的软件,如果您的项目需要复杂的三维建模和仿真,那么FreeCAD可能是一个更好的选择,如果您的项目主要是二维设计,LibreCAD可能更适合您。
4.2 学习曲线
考虑软件的学习曲线,如果您是UG编程的新手,选择一个用户界面友好、文档齐全的软件会更容易上手。
4.3 社区支持
一个活跃的社区可以为您提供宝贵的帮助和资源,在选择软件时,查看其社区的活跃度和可用资源。
4.4 兼容性
确保所选软件与您的其他工具和文件格式兼容,这将有助于您在项目中无缝地使用软件。
利用免费资源提升UG编程技能
5.1 在线教程和课程
利用在线资源学习UG编程,许多网站提供免费的教程和课程,帮助您从基础到高级逐步掌握UG编程技能。
5.2 论坛和社区
加入UG编程相关的论坛和社区,与其他用户交流经验和技巧,这些社区通常是获取帮助和解决问题的好地方。
5.3 实践项目
通过实践项目来提升您的UG编程技能,尝试使用免费软件完成实际的设计和制造任务,这将帮助您更好地理解和应用UG编程技术。
虽然免费UG编程软件在功能上可能不如商业版全面,但它们为初学者和预算有限的用户提供了一个学习和实践的平台,通过合理选择和利用这些免费资源,您可以逐步提升自己的UG编程技能,并在实际项目中应用这些技能,持续学习和实践是提高UG编程能力的关键。
本文中提到的软件名称和版本可能随时间变化而变化,因此在选择和使用软件时,建议访问官方网站或社区获取最新信息,免费软件的功能和支持可能有限,对于专业或商业用途,可能需要考虑购买商业版软件以获得更全面的功能和技术支持。
转载请注明来自我有希望,本文标题:《探索UG编程,免费软件资源的全面指南》